Event Description

Georgia Aquarium will host a weekend-long car and motorcycle show, Oceans and Autos. In honor of Father’s Day, June 17-19 come view over $20 million worth of cars and motorcycles on display. Car show guests will also have the chance to meet the host of “My Classic Car,” Dennis Gage, Saturday, June 18 from 10am – 4pm! Guests may visit both the Aquarium and car show for the price of general admission, plus a $10 car show admission price. For guests only wanting to attend the car show, a $20 ticket option is also available. Children 12 and under receive free admission to the Oceans and Autos Car Show.
